Redbank Plains and Brookwater are neighbouring areas with very different social and economic profiles. Brookwater is much wealthier, with a typical weekly household income of $3,637 compared to $1,516 in Redbank Plains. Education levels are also far higher in Brookwater, where 36.4% of adults hold a bachelor degree or higher, compared to 10.1% in Redbank Plains. This wealth gap is reflected in the housing market; Redbank Plains is a high-rental area where 57.8% of homes are rented, while 65.3% of homes in Brookwater are owned with a mortgage.

These two places have diverged sharply over time, with the gaps in income and education widening. Despite these trends, they share some basic physical traits: both have about the same number of people per home and nearly every house in both areas is within a 15-minute walk of a park. Redbank Plains is generally more accessible for daily needs, with a much higher share of homes within walking distance of schools, groceries, and health services.
